SAFETY EVALUATION OF THE BOLT FOR ALUMINIUM TRAIN CAR-BODY USE
In year 2000, KRRI (Korea Railroad Research Institute) developed an aluminium train car-body to save manufacturing expenses as well as to increase efficiency to recycle used material. One of the problems to process the aluminium car-body manufacturing is to verify connection safety between underframe and heavy railway equipment. In this paper, new type bolt and nut are evaluated for safety by the finite element method. Based on UIC Regulation for fastening railway equipment, the loads in service condition and buffing impact condition with three difference directions such as longitudinal, transverse and vertical direction are applied on the bolt.
